“…Agomelatine decreases production of interleukin-1-beta (IL-1-beta), interleukin-6 (IL-6), and tumor necrosis factor-alpha (TNF-alpha), the main mediators of the "cytokine storm" and septic shock). It also depresses the activity of NLRP3 inflammasome, induces autologous processes, prevents macrophage infiltration and microglial cell activation, and decreases cell apoptosis by its effect on the NF-kappa-signaling cascade (Molteni et al, 2013;Hyeon et al, 2017;Kalkman & Feuerbach, 2016). It is hypothesized that the above properties may underlie the antidepressive effectiveness of agomelatine against MDEs occurring after COVID-19.…”
